Frequently Asked Questions about Baldwin County
What type of rentals are currently available in Baldwin County?
There are currently 306 Apartments for Rent in Baldwin County, AL with pricing that ranges from $490 to $3,978. There are also 139 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Baldwin County ranging from $875 to $7,999.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Baldwin County?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Baldwin County ranges from $875 to $7,999 with an average monthly rent of $2,966.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Baldwin County?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Baldwin County range from $990 to $3,600,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,400 to $4,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,500 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,750.
